Description
Welcome to a traditional one-bedroom (plus child's bedroom/study) first-floor city flat which forms part of a C-listed classical tenement building (1861) within Edinburgh's Old Town conservation area and World Heritage Site. Enjoying one of the most sought-after postcodes in the capital, this home offers bright and airy accommodation with all the charm and character of period architecture, alongside original details. Whilst certain aspects of the property require refurbishment, it remains a thoroughly exciting prospect, especially given its highly prestigious setting within easy strolling distance of all the city centre offers. Please note, the property is to be sold as seen. No warranties or guarantees shall be provided in relation to any of the services, moveables, and/or appliances included in the price as these items are to be left in a sold as seen condition. Features • A traditional first-floor flat in the Old Town • Part of a C-listed Victorian building • Highly sought-after, city centre location • Period features and wooden floorboards • Entrance hall with built-in storage • Living room with period charm • Good-size kitchen • One spacious double bedroom • Flexible child's bedroom/study • Three-piece shower room • Controlled permit parking (Zone 3) • Traditional sash windows and shutters • Gas central heating system
